President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has approved the appointment of Professor Shu’aib Aliyu as the new Executive Secretary of the Petroleum Technology Development Fund.
Eko Hot Blog reports that Aliyu takes over from Ahmed Aminu, who stepped down from the role to pursue his governorship ambition ahead of the 2027 elections in Adamawa State.

In a related development, the President also approved the renewal of the appointment of Sule Abdulaziz as the Managing Director and Chief Executive Officer of the Transmission Company of Nigeria for a second and final term.
The appointments take immediate effect.
According to a statement issued by the Special Adviser to the President on Information and Strategy, Bayo Onanuga, Aliyu brings extensive experience in academia, research, and institutional leadership to his new role.
The Presidency said his appointment reflects a commitment to strengthening institutions within Nigeria’s petroleum sector, particularly in the area of human capital development and innovation.

Aliyu is expected to reposition the PTDF to deliver greater impact in supporting the oil and gas industry in line with national priorities.
On Abdulaziz’s reappointment, the statement noted that the decision followed a review of his performance at the helm of the transmission company.
It highlighted improvements recorded under his leadership, including enhanced grid stability, expansion of transmission capacity, and ongoing system modernisation.
The Presidency also acknowledged his role in promoting regional electricity integration through the West African Power Pool initiative.
President Tinubu urged both appointees to carry out their responsibilities with diligence and integrity, in line with his administration’s Renewed Hope Agenda.
